JKEDI explores collaboration opportunities with EDII Ahmedabad

Jammu: In furtherance towards fostering entrepreneurship and innovation in Jammu and Kashmir, Director JKEDI, Rajinder Sharma (JKAS) Saturday met Dr. Sunil Sharma, Director General, Entrepreneurship Development Institute of India (EDII) Ahmedabad to explore the collaborative programs and innovative intervention for training programs and incubator establishment in the UT of Jammu and Kashmir.

The meeting held at Entrepreneurship Development Institute of India (EDII) campus, Ahmedabad in which few officials of CIIBM, a program vertical of JKEDI also participated, aimed at exploring potential collaborations between JKEDI and EDII Ahmedabad to strengthen the startup ecosystem in the J&K. Both the institutions discussed strategic partnerships that could lead to enhanced support for budding entrepreneurs in the region, with a specific emphasis on innovation based startups.

During the interaction, Director JKEDI expressed optimism about the collaboration, stating, “The engagement with EDII Ahmedabad, opens new doors for young entrepreneurs in J&K. With the right guidance and support from prestigious institutions like EDII Ahmedabad we are confident that the entrepreneurial landscape in our region will witness significant growth.”

Dr. Sunil Shukla, Director General, EDII Ahmedabad pressed on the importance of collaborative efforts in driving innovation across the country. He said, “At EDII, we believe that nurturing regional ecosystems is key to the overall development of the nation’s entrepreneurial framework. Our collaboration with JKEDI will be a step forward in creating a robust ecosystem for innovation and entrepreneurship in Jammu and Kashmir.”

The meeting also laid the groundwork for future training programs, knowledge exchange, and the establishment of incubators to support startups and entrepreneurs in J&K. Both institutions agreed to further explore avenues for partnership to contribute to the region’s socio-economic development through entrepreneurship.

The meeting was attended by Zahid Ali Dar, Project Manager and Sorab Mengi, Associate Project Manager from the Centre for Innovation, Incubation and Business Modelling (CIIBM), a program vertical of JKEDI.
